peak

/piːk/

noun

Bir dağın veya tepenin sivri zirvesi.

The pointed top of a mountain or hill.

  • We reached the peak before sunset.
  • Snow covered the mountain peak.
  • The climbers aimed for the highest peak.
  • Economists predict that oil production will reach its peak within the next decade before gradually declining.
  • The university's enrollment reached a peak in the 1970s and has remained relatively stable since then.
  • Athletes typically achieve their performance peak in their mid-twenties, though training methods can extend competitive careers.
noun

Bir şeyin en yüksek veya en yoğun noktası; maksimum seviye.

The highest or most intense point of something; the maximum level.

  • Tourism is at its peak in summer.
  • She was at the peak of her career.
  • Sales reached their peak in December.
verb

En yüksek noktaya veya maksimum seviyeye ulaşmak.

To reach the highest point or maximum level.

  • Interest in the show peaked last month.
  • Her performance peaked during the finals.
  • Prices peaked in the third quarter.
adjective

En yüksek veya maksimum seviyede; en yoğun veya en popüler zamanda gerçekleşen.

At the highest or maximum level; occurring at the busiest or most popular time.

  • Avoid traveling during peak hours.
  • Peak season rates apply in July.
  • The gym is crowded at peak times.
